ARLINGTON, Va. - PV2 Alijah Leach (left), Sgt. Gabriel Sudharto (Center), Pfc. Austin Goodwin (right), tomb sentinels assigned to the 3d U.S. Infantry Regiment (The Old Guard), salute in honor of the unknown soldier during the Changing of the Guard, Tomb of the Unknown Soldier, Arlington National Cemetery, Arlington, Va., January 25, 2026. Snow fell throughout the National Capital Region, yet sentinels remained on post, continuing their uninterrupted vigil over the Tomb of the Unknown Soldier. (U.S. Army photo by Staff Sgt. Oscar Toscano)
